Crowds in July
Arches averages 170,157 recreation visits in July — 87% of what May, the peak month, draws. That crowd level sets the tone for parking, permits and lodging — book early and start days at dawn.
Weather & daylight
Daytime heat is the story (highs average 99°F), and nights stay mild (lows average 70°F). It is typically dry (0.7″ of precipitation). Mid-month daylight runs 14.6 hours.
NOAA 1991–2020 monthly normals, station ARCHES NP HQS, UT US (9 mi from park coordinates, 4,093 ft elevation) — conditions vary inside the park, especially with elevation. Daylight computed for the 15th of July.
What to pack for Arches in July
Computed from the month's weather normals above — not a generic list.
- Sun hat, SPF 50+ and 3L+ water capacity — highs average 99°F
- Electrolyte tablets (heat-illness prevention) — at highs of 99°F, water alone is not enough — dehydration is the real risk
- Sturdy broken-in footwear, navigation and a basic first-aid kit — every park, every month
